Literature summary for 4.2.99.21 extracted from

  • Olucha, J.; Meneely, K.M.; Lamb, A.L.
    Modification of residue 42 of the active site loop with a lysine-mimetic side chain rescues isochorismate-pyruvate lyase activity in Pseudomonas aeruginosa PchB (2012), Biochemistry, 51, 7525-7532.

Protein Variants

Protein Variants Comment Organism
C7A mutant has a reduced catalytic free energy of activation of up to 0.17 kcal/mol Pseudomonas aeruginosa
C7A/K42C mutant has a reduced catalytic free energy of activation of up to 4.2 kcal/mol. Treatment with bromoethylamine leads to 64% recovery of activity Pseudomonas aeruginosa
K42A mutation leads to the recovery in catalytic free energy of activation of 2.5–2.7 kcal/mol compared to mutant K42C. Exogenous addition of ethylamine to the K42A variant leads to a neglible recovery of activity, whereas addition of propylamine causes an additional modest loss in catalytic power Pseudomonas aeruginosa
K42C mutant has a reduced catalytic free energy of activation of up to 4.4 kcal/mol. Treatment with bromoethylamine leads to 55% recovery of activity Pseudomonas aeruginosa

Reaction

Reaction Comment Organism Reaction ID
isochorismate = salicylate + pyruvate the lysine42 residue is required in a specific conformation to stabilize the transition state Pseudomonas aeruginosa
